Report: Massimiliano Allegri agrees new Juventus deal

A report claims that head coach Massimiliano Allegri will sign a 12-month contract extension with Italian champions Juventus tomorrow.

Juventus will reportedly confirm that Massimiliano Allegri has agreed terms on a new contract at some stage tomorrow.

The 48-year-old's previous deal had been due to expire in the summer of 2017.

However, according to Gazzetta dello Sport, the head coach has now secured a 12-month extension.

Under Allegri's guidance, Juve have won two Serie A titles and one Coppa Italia.

They also reached the final of last season's Champions League, where they were defeated by Barcelona.
